<p>For Aleksander Doba, pitting himself against the wide-open sea — storms, sunstroke, monotony, hunger and loneliness — was a way to feel alive in old age. Today, listen to the story of a man who paddled toward the existential crisis that is life and crossed the Atlantic alone in a kayak. Three times.</p><p><a href="https://www.nytimes.com/2021/03/11/world/europe/aleksander-doba-dead.html" target="_blank">Mr. Doba died</a> on Feb. 22 on the summit of Mount Kilimanjaro in Tanzania, Africa. He was 74.</p><p><i>This story was written by Elizabeth Weil and recorded by Audm.
